You know what's wild? When you really break down how A$AP Rocky went from Harlem streets to becoming a legitimate mogul, his net worth tells a story way bigger than just numbers. We're talking about a guy who turned music, fashion, and pure creative vision into a multimillion-dollar empire.
Let me back up. Rocky—Rakim Athelaston Mayers—dropped Live. Love. ASAP back in 2011 and basically changed the game. That mixtape went viral, landed him a $3M deal with RCA, and suddenly he wasn't just another rapper. By the time Long. Live. ASAP hit in 2013, dude was already rewriting the rulebook on how to build a career across multiple industries.
Here's where it gets interesting. Most artists make money one way. Rocky's doing it like five different ways simultaneously. His music catalog alone—we're talking albums like At. Long. Last. ASAP and Testing—generates millions annually just from streaming. Billions of streams add up fast. Then there's touring. His live shows sell out arenas; we're talking eight-figure numbers when you factor in ticket sales and merch. In 2024, after everything reopened post-COVID, his touring revenue hit new heights.
But music? That's honestly just the foundation. The real wealth multiplication happened through fashion. Rocky didn't just become a fashion icon—he became THE bridge between streetwear and luxury. Collaborations with Dior, Raf Simons, Gucci? Those aren't just endorsements; they're limited drops that sell out in hours. His creative agency AWGE, founded in 2015, evolved into this multimillion-dollar creative powerhouse. We're talking music videos, art installations, brand partnerships—AWGE is basically its own economy at this point.
Then you've got the real estate side. Penthouse in Manhattan, mansion in Beverly Hills, apartment in Paris. Rocky's property portfolio sits somewhere north of $20 million. These aren't just flex purchases; they're appreciating assets generating passive income through rentals. Dude also flips properties for profit. That's not accidental wealth—that's strategic.
The endorsement game is another revenue stream most people sleep on. Calvin Klein, Mercedes-Benz, Samsung—these deals run into the millions. Rocky's influence with younger demographics is literally valuable to these brands. Add in his tech investments, crypto plays, and NFT involvement, and you're looking at someone who stays ahead of emerging trends.
What really sets Rocky apart is his film and TV presence. Acting in Dope, producing and directing through AWGE—these aren't side hustles; they're legit income sources. His work behind the camera gets praised for innovation, which means more opportunities, more deals, more revenue.
So when people ask about A$AP Rocky's net worth in 2024, the answer's around $20 million. But that number doesn't capture the full picture. It's not just what he's worth today—it's the infrastructure he's built to keep generating wealth across music, fashion, tech, real estate, and entertainment. Most artists plateau. Rocky keeps evolving.
What's equally notable is how he's using that platform. Heavy into philanthropy, vocal about social justice, especially after the Sweden situation in 2019. That stuff enhances his brand credibility and legacy beyond just the money.
Looking forward, his influence on pop culture shows zero signs of slowing. New album coming, AWGE expanding into VR and gaming, more collaborations with major names. The A$AP Rocky net worth trajectory suggests continued growth—probably significant growth—because he's not relying on one income stream. That diversification is the real wealth hack.
Compared to his peers, Rocky's positioned differently. He's not just a rapper with endorsements. He's a creative entrepreneur who happens to rap, make fashion, produce content, and invest strategically. That's why his net worth keeps climbing and why he's become one of the most influential cultural figures of his generation. The money follows the influence, and Rocky's influence is everywhere.
